JavaWeb医院挂号预约管理系统是一个基于Java EE技术的医疗信息系统,用于实现医院挂号、预约、查询等功能。该系统采用B/S架构,通过浏览器访问服务器端进行操作,具有用户友好的界面和稳定的性能。
系统主要包括以下几个模块:
1. 用户管理模块:负责用户的注册、登录、权限分配等操作。用户可以通过输入用户名和密码进行登录,系统会根据用户的角色分配相应的权限。
2. 挂号模块:用户可以在系统中选择科室、医生、就诊时间等信息,提交挂号申请。系统会将用户的信息保存到数据库中,并生成一个唯一的挂号单号。
3. 预约模块:用户可以查看自己的预约记录,包括就诊时间、医生信息等。用户还可以取消或修改预约信息。
4. 查询模块:用户可以通过输入科室、医生、就诊时间等信息,查询相关的挂号信息。系统会从数据库中检索符合条件的记录,并将结果以列表的形式展示给用户。
5. 报表模块:系统可以根据需要生成各种报表,如挂号统计表、预约统计表等。这些报表可以方便医院管理人员进行数据分析和决策。
6. 系统管理模块:管理员可以对系统进行日常维护和管理,如添加、删除、修改用户信息,更新数据库结构等。
系统采用MVC设计模式,将业务逻辑、数据访问和页面显示分离,提高了代码的可维护性和可扩展性。同时,系统还采用了缓存技术,减少了数据库的访问次数,提高了系统的性能。
为了提高系统的可用性和稳定性,系统还采用了多种技术手段,如负载均衡、故障转移、数据备份等。此外,系统还支持多种数据库连接方式,如MySQL、Oracle等,以满足不同场景的需求。
总之,JavaWeb医院挂号预约管理系统是一个功能强大、易于使用的医疗信息系统,可以帮助医院提高工作效率,降低运营成本,为患者提供更好的服务。